English words for daira numa

 
3 English words found
 
 English WordsUrdu
1. circular daira numa
 
2. cycloid daira numa
 
3. cycloidal daira numa
 

 

romance

Word of the day

ablution -
وضو
The ritual washing of a priest`s hands or of sacred vessels.